Feb 9, 2026

Routine

Score: 92Grade: A5 violations
Comments

An informal inspection will occur on 2/18/26 to verify that all violations have been corrected. Repeat violations observed today (14A .04(4)(k) and 15C .05(7)(a)2,3)). Three consecutive violations of the same code provision on routine inspections will result in a permit suspension. Note: Ensure the date when the last shellstock (e.g., oysters and mussels) is served is recorded on every tag or box. Note: Allergen notification guidance provided to person in charge. All cold holding temperatures in compliance. Questions/comments? 770-963-5132 or gnrhealth.com

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

4-2A: .04(4)(c)1(iv)Observed carrot and radish mixture stored uncovered in walk-in cooler. Observed container of flour mix stored uncovered in dry storage area.// Food must be protected from cross contamination by storing the food in packages, covered containers, or wrappings, except for loosely covered, or uncovered containers in which food is being cooled if protected from overhead contamination. (C) Corrective Actions: Lids were placed on food containers.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

4-2B: .05(6)(n)Observed employee attempting to sanitize dishes in chemical warewashing machine that was dispensing 0ppm chlorine.// A chemical sanitizer used in a sanitizing solution for a manual or mechanical operations must meet a specified minimum concentration (for chlorine sanitizer it must be 50-100 ppm; for quat ammonia, it must be used according to the manufacturer's specifications). (P) Corrective Actions: Dishes were placed at three compartment sink to be manually washed, rinsed, and sanitized.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: Yes

14A: .04(4)(k)Observed scoop in ice with handle in direct contact with the ice. Observed plastic containers with no handles being used as in-use scoops in flour mixture, MSG, potato starch, and peanuts. SECOND CONSECUTIVE VIOLATION ON ROUTINE INSPECTION.// During pauses in food preparation or dispensing, food preparation and dispensing utensils shall be stored: 1. in the food with their handles above the top of the food and the container; 2. in running water of sufficient velocity to flush particulates to the drain, if used with moist food such as ice cream or mashed potatoes; 3. in a clean, dry container; or 4. in a container of water if the water is maintained at a temperature of at least 135°F (57°C) and the container is cleaned at the required frequency. (C) Corrective Actions: Utensils were removed from food.//

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

15B: .05(6)(d),(e)Observed warewashing machine dispensing 0ppm chlorine.// A warewashing machine and its auxiliary components shall be operated in accordance with the machine's data plate and other manufacturer's instructions. (C)

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: Yes

15C: .05(7)(a)2,3Observed accumulation of residue and debris on the following nonfood-contact surfaces: shelving in walk-in cooler, metal shelves above prep areas in kitchen, top surface of warewashing machine. SECOND CONSECUTIVE VIOLATION// Nonfood-contact surfaces of equipment shall be kept free of an accumulation of dust, dirt, food residue, and other debris. (C)

Sep 29, 2025

Routine

Score: 94Grade: A8 violations
Comments

An informal inspection will occur on 10/9/25 to verify that all violations have been corrected. Facility has shellstock (oysters) on site. Shellstock tags observed in compliance. Note: Ensure ventilation fan covers in restrooms are kept free of dust.// Note: All cold holding temperatures in compliance. Questions/comments? 770-963-5132 or gnrhealth.com

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

12A: .04(4)(z)Observed several vegetables (mostly herbs or leafy greens) stored wrapped in newspaper in walk-in cooler.// Food shall be protected from miscellaneous sources of contamination. (C)

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

14A: .04(4)(k)Observed scoops with no handles stored in two containers of loose leaf tea and a container of MSG.// During pauses in food preparation or dispensing, food preparation and dispensing utensils shall be stored: 1. in the food with their handles above the top of the food and the container; 2. in running water of sufficient velocity to flush particulates to the drain, if used with moist food such as ice cream or mashed potatoes; 3. in a clean, dry container; or 4. in a container of water if the water is maintained at a temperature of at least 135°F (57°C) and the container is cleaned at the required frequency. (C) Corrective Actions: Scoops were removed from food.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

14B: .05(10)(e) 1,2,4Observed several plastic cups stored as clean and stacked wet.// Clean equipment and utensils shall be stored in a self-draining position that allows air drying and covered or inverted. (C) Corrective Actions: Cups were separated to air dry.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

15A: .05(1)(i)Observed several shelves used for storing food and clean utensils lined with cardboard.// Nonfood-contact surfaces of equipment that are exposed to splash, spillage, or other food soiling or that require frequent cleaning shall be constructed of a corrosion-resistant, nonabsorbent, and smooth material. (C) Corrective Actions: Cardboard was removed from shelving.//

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

15A: .05(6)(a)Observed gasket on bottom door of prep cooler across from cooking area is loose and not in good repair (being held in place with packing tape).// Equipment shall be maintained in a state of repair and condition that meets the requirements specified under subsections (1) and (2)of this Rule. (C)

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

15B: .05(6)(d),(e)Observed interior surfaces of warewashing machine (top, sides, and bottom) and top exterior surface has buildup of residue and food debris.// A warewashing machine; the compartments of sinks, basins, or other receptacles used for washing and rinsing equipment, utensils, or raw foods, or laundering wiping cloths; and drainboards or other equipment used to substitute for drainboards shall be cleaned before use; throughout the day at a frequency necessary to prevent recontamination of equipment and utensils and to ensure that the equipment performs its intended function; and if used, at least every 24 hours. (C)

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

15C: .05(7)(a)2,3Observed handles of large white bins and top of brown sugar container with accumulation of food residue. Observed top of standing freezer in front area with dust accumulation.// Nonfood-contact surfaces of equipment shall be kept free of an accumulation of dust, dirt, food residue, and other debris. (C)

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

17D: .07(5)(d)Observed vent hood filters and area below filters with accumulation of grease.// Intake and exhaust air ducts shall be cleaned and filters changed so they are not a source of contamination by dust, dirt, and other materials. (C)

May 20, 2025

Routine

Score: 91Grade: A3 violations
Comments

Note: Empty spice containers and boba containers shall not be used for other foods. Note: Ensure that gaskets on coolers are kept in good repair. Note: Dining counters and table-tops shall be cleaned and sanitized routinely after removing all soiled tableware and food trays shall be cleaned and sanitized after each use by one of the following methods: (i) A two step method in which one cloth, rinsed in sanitizing solution is used to clean food debris from the surface and a second cloth in separate sanitizing solution is used to rinse; (ii) Sanitizing solution is sprayed onto the surface and the surface is then wiped clean with a disposable towel; (iii) If used for cleaning and sanitizing, single-use disposable sanitizer wipes shall be used in accordance with EPA-registered label use instructions Note: All cold holding temperatures in compliance unless otherwise stated. Questions/comments? 770-963-5132 or gnrhealth.com

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

2-2D: .06(2)(c)Observed handwashing sink next to ice machine with no hot water 85F or above.// A handwashing sink shall be equipped to provide tempered water at a temperature of at least 85F through a mixing valve or combination faucet. (Pf) Corrective Actions: Person in charge opened hot water valve underneath sink during inspection. Sink now provides hot water above 85F.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

4-2B: .05(7)(a)1Observed interior surfaces of ice machine with black mold-like accumulation.// Equipment food-contact surfaces and utensils shall be clean to sight and touch. (Pf) Corrective Actions: Ice machine was cleaned during inspection.//

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

13A: .02(1)(d)The most recent inspection report is not displayed. An older inspection report from 6/29/23 is posted.// The most current inspection report shall be prominently displayed in public view at all times, within fifteen feet of the front or primary public door and between five feet and seven feet from the floor and in an area where it can be read at a distance of one foot away. (C) Corrective Actions: Today's inspection report was given to person in charge and posted.//
